A man was seriously injured in a stabbing at a park in Oswestry during the early hours.

The victim had to have trauma care at the scene before he was taken to hospital accompanied by Air Ambulance medics.

Brynhafod Park was cordoned off with police guarding the entrance to the open land, popular with morning dog walkers.
